Вопросы по теме 'gatling'

Gatling all request завершился неудачно, сеть недоступна
Я использую последнюю версию Gatling 2.0.0.-M3a под Debian Wheezy, это мой первый тест этого инструмента. Весь сценарий провалился со следующими ошибками: 15:36:41.929 [WARN ] i.g.h.a.AsyncHandler - Request 'request_1' failed: Network is...
372 просмотров
schedule 21.03.2024

Выполнять множественные проверки, даже если первая не удалась
В приведенном ниже примере я выполняю запрос POST к веб-службе REST с помощью Gatling. Есть две проверки. Я проверяю, что статус возвращается как OK, и я также проверяю, что в структуре JSON не было возвращено errorString. Если веб-служба REST...
646 просмотров
schedule 18.05.2022

Завершается ли группа {} до того, как управление переходит к следующей команде блока в цепочке?
У меня есть сценарий Gatling (1.5.5), который выглядит примерно так: .group( "name" ) { // do a sequence of things that are a logical flow (in this case, log in) .exitHereIfFailed } .feed( source ) .exec( session => println(...
571 просмотров
schedule 25.12.2023

Как сделать вызов вложенного запроса в Gatling scala
Я смог вызвать вложенный запрос на 2-х уровнях, но на третьем уровне он не выполняется, так что я делаю это правильно или нет, если нет, то как правильно выполнить вложенный запрос на основе ответа Вот мой код, который я использовал import...
1011 просмотров
schedule 24.03.2024

Как связать мой нагрузочный тест Gatling на основе Maven в один JAR?
Я создал нагрузочный тест Гатлинга, используя архетип highcharts . Я решил не загружать последний ZIP-файл Gatling и не создавать симуляцию в извлеченной папке, поскольку я полагаюсь на количество зависимостей в общедоступных и частных...
1106 просмотров

Использование текущей даты в тесте Гатлинга
Я пытаюсь загрузить тестовое приложение с помощью Gatling, и приложению требуется, чтобы текущая дата была вставлена ​​​​в тест: .formParam("dateCreation", "07/01/2015 16:48:04") Если это жестко закодировано, это, кажется, расстраивает...
3173 просмотров
schedule 07.02.2023

Стресс-тестирование Gatling на AWS, потоки остаются активными
Я установил два экземпляра AMI (redhat), один с брокером ActiveMQ 5.11, другой с некоторыми инструментами стресс-тестирования (gatling с Mqtt, mqtt-stres и т. д.). Я остановил службу iptables (брандмауэр) на обоих экземплярах. Группы безопасности...
748 просмотров

Основной класс не найден при использовании jar манифеста с JavaExec в Gradle
У меня есть приведенный ниже скрипт gradle из структуры Jhipster . Он используется для запуска тестов Gatling, и из-за ограничения командной строки в окнах я пробовал использовать подход jar только для манифеста. Подробное обсуждение этого вопроса...
1484 просмотров
schedule 17.09.2023

Интерпретация результатов для простого сценария Гатлинга с 1 пользователем и охватом 20000 рупий
Помещение Rest API в scala / spray Простой метод, который всегда возвращает ОК Я стараюсь достичь в среднем 20 тыс. Запросов в секунду Обе машины (тестирующая и протестированная) хорошо настроены (выделенные серверы EC2, каждый со своим...
1186 просмотров
schedule 30.01.2024

Тест Gatling JMS, похоже, не заканчивается
В моем тесте JMS gatling, кажется, получает ответное сообщение, потому что он регистрирует: 15:52:26.101 [DEBUG] i.g.j.JmsReqReplyAction - Message received ID:1D32A51DC20C42D5E05316A0620A8E4E 15:52:26.101 [TRACE] i.g.j.JmsReqReplyAction -...
298 просмотров
schedule 02.12.2023

Как мне получить фактическое значение из этого в Scala: Right (Vector (abc))
Я использую Gatling для тестирования службы на основе WebSocket, и для анализа ответа json я использую следующее: val initiator = JsonPath.query("$.header.initiator", json).right.map(_.toVector) Инициатор печати говорит мне, что это:...
1192 просмотров
schedule 02.01.2023

Преобразовать в карту из списка в Gatling
Мне нужно сформировать это: { “item” : “hardcoded_value”, “item2” : “hardcoded_value”, “item3” : “hardcoded_value”, } В блоке exec я пытаюсь: // list with items [“item1”, “ item2”, “ item3”] val theList =...
1018 просмотров
schedule 21.02.2024

Gatling 2: показатель среднего арифметического в отчете
В настоящее время отчет Gatling предоставляет следующие показатели минимум максимум 50-й процентиль 75-й процентиль 95-й процентиль 99-й процентиль иметь в виду среднеквадратичное отклонение но он не дает среднего...
288 просмотров
schedule 25.02.2022

Как передать переменную сеанса от одного объекта к другому в Gatling?
Я извлекаю переменную сеанса в ObjectA и хочу передать ее в ObjectB. Как лучше всего этого добиться? object ObjectA { val foo = exec(jsfPost("Request1", "/something.xhtml") .formParam("SUBMIT", "1")...
6577 просмотров
schedule 24.05.2022

можно ли запустить тест гатлинга и селена вместе
Я новичок в нагрузочном тестировании. Я хочу использовать гатлинг для тестирования. кажется, основан на scala (который работает над JVM) Я хочу использовать некоторые старые тесты селена (основанные на java). Можно ли создать проект java и...
2193 просмотров
schedule 16.07.2022

Как контролировать порядок выполнения операторов exec в сценарии Гатлинга?
В следующем фрагменте кода я хочу, чтобы функция сеанса выполнялась перед HttpRequestbBuilder SolrProductionDataRequestBuilder, но я не могу это сделать... Относительно новый для Scala и Gatling, поэтому, пожалуйста, простите здесь вопиющую ошибку......
2013 просмотров
schedule 22.10.2022

Как записать значение из ответа в файл в гатлинге?
У меня есть скрипт, который создает новый referenceId каждый раз, когда он выполняется. я использовал .check(regex("orders.(.*?)\"").saveAs("referenceId"))) для извлечения referenceId. Теперь, как я могу записать/добавить его в файл, не...
4495 просмотров
schedule 02.02.2022

Автоматически генерировать сценарии Гатлинга
В настоящее время мы поддерживаем наши симуляции Гатлинга вручную, если список вызовов REST страницы изменяется. Если разработчик расширяет страницу новым вызовом, он должен не забыть добавить этот вызов в симуляцию Гатлинга. Как убедиться, что...
263 просмотров
schedule 05.05.2024

Как правильно запустить Gatling из автономного приложения?
Мне нужно запустить симуляцию Гатлинга из основного приложения. Вариант использования следующий: Приложение считывает спецификацию и генерирует тестовые примеры на основе этой спецификации. Тестовые случаи преобразуются в сценарии Гатлинга....
504 просмотров
schedule 16.12.2023

Запуск Gatling из контейнера
Я использую контейнер denvazh/gatling, и все работает хорошо, за исключением одной вещи, которую я пытаюсь передать в виде списка симуляций: Attaching to gatling gatling_1 | GATLING_HOME is set to /opt/gatling gatling_1 | Choose a simulation...
4563 просмотров
schedule 23.03.2023